Police in Chandler are investigating a domestic violence-related shooting at an apartment complex in the East Valley city.

The shooting, according to a statement, happened at an apartment complex in the area of Dobson and Frye Roads.

"There is a suspect in custody and there is no threat or danger to the community," read a portion of Chandler Police's statement. Officials say they are not releasing the identities of those involved due to pending notifications of family members.
